[age 11]
I see a girl sitting there under the tree and I can't help but go over. She's alone with a book in her hands, smiling. She flips the page and her laugh cartwheels across the ground to me."I'm June," I say. She looks up at me with zinger bright blue eyes, somehow I just know I'm going to marry her. I think I'll have to wait till we're at least seventeen to propose though.
"You hungry?" She asks and offers up half of her sandwich. I bite into it. Peanut butter.
"What are you reading?" I ask with my mouth full.
"Alice in Wonderland," she replies.
"What's it about?"
"A girl chasing a talking rabbit and falling down a rabbit hole."
"Cool." I smile.
"You wanna play noughts and crosses?"
"Yeah," I say. She beat me. She always beats me.
